
Warm, golden, and deeply aromatic, this sipping tonic is the kind of thing that makes you feel taken care of from the inside out. Fresh ginger and turmeric steep directly into rich bone broth, creating a savory-meets-earthy base that's both grounding and invigorating. A smashed garlic clove and a splash of apple cider vinegar round out the depth, while Ceylon cinnamon adds a gentle warmth that lingers. For anyone navigating a mustard sensitivity, this recipe is a genuinely safe haven โ every ingredient is clean and straightforward, with no condiments or spice blends that might sneak in hidden allergens. A touch of honey and fresh lemon juice are optional finishing moves that brighten the whole cup without overwhelming the savory notes. It comes together in under fifteen minutes and strains beautifully into two mugs, making it an easy ritual for a slow morning or a wind-down evening. Simple, nourishing, and completely fuss-free.

Combine the bone broth, ginger, turmeric, and garlic in a small saucepan over medium heat. Bring to a gentle simmer, then reduce the heat to low and cook for 8 minutes, until the broth is fragrant and the ginger and turmeric have fully infused.
Remove from the heat and stir in the apple cider vinegar and Ceylon cinnamon. Add the honey and lemon juice, if using.
